Description
With unprecedented access to the Googleplex, veteran technology reporter Steven Levy tells the inside story of Google, the most successful and admired company of our time. Few companies in history have ever been as successful and as admired as Google, the company that has transformed the Internet and become an indispensable part of our lives. How has Google done it? While they were still students at Stanford, founders Larry Page and Sergey Brin revolutionized Internet search. They followed this brilliant innovation with another, as two of Google’s earliest employees found a way to do what no one else had: make billions of dollars from Internet advertising.
